ABB Bailey IPBLC01 Detailed Product Description
Product Introduction
The ABB Bailey IPBLC01 is a high-performance communication module designed for the INFI 90 Distributed Control System (DCS). It serves as an interface processor, enabling seamless communication between various control system components. The IPBLC01 efficiently bridges field devices and control units, ensuring reliable data transfer and optimized process control. Its robust architecture is engineered to support complex industrial automation tasks, providing users with a dependable solution for critical process environments.
This module is highly valued across industries for its integration capabilities, stability, and ABB’s long-standing reputation for quality. Whether in power generation, chemical processing, or manufacturing, the IPBLC01 ensures continuous operation with minimal downtime, contributing to operational excellence.

Technical Specifications
Parameter | Specification |
---|---|
Model Number | IPBLC01 |
Product Type | Interface Processor Module |
Dimensions | 190 mm × 130 mm × 45 mm |
Weight | 0.85 kg |
Operating Voltage | 24 V DC |
Power Consumption | 10 W |
Communication Interface | High-Speed Serial Communication |
Ambient Temperature | 0°C to +60°C |
Storage Temperature | -40°C to +85°C |
Humidity | 5% to 95% RH, non-condensing |
Mounting Method | DIN Rail or Panel Mounting |
Certifications | CE, RoHS, UL |
Compatibility | INFI 90 DCS, Harmony Series |
Response Time | < 1 ms |
Insulation Resistance | ≥100 MΩ at 500 V DC |
Vibration Resistance | 10-55 Hz, 1.5 mm amplitude |

Frequently Asked Questions (FAQ)
Q1: What is the primary function of the ABB Bailey IPBLC01 module?
A1: The IPBLC01 acts as an interface processor that enables seamless communication between field devices and control units within the INFI 90 DCS system, ensuring real-time data transmission and process control.
Q2: Can the IPBLC01 module be used in high-temperature environments?
A2: Yes, the module is designed to operate reliably in ambient temperatures ranging from 0°C to +60°C, making it suitable for most industrial environments.
Q3: How is the IPBLC01 module installed in the system?
A3: The module can be mounted on a DIN rail or directly onto a panel. Proper wiring and grounding must be ensured, followed by configuration and system integration steps.
Q4: What maintenance does the IPBLC01 module require?
A4: Regular inspection of connectors and cables for wear, ensuring secure mounting, and verifying module operation through system diagnostics are recommended maintenance practices.
Q5: Is the IPBLC01 compatible with other ABB control systems?
A5: Yes, it is fully compatible with ABB’s INFI 90 system and related modules like NTCL01, INNIS21, and IMMPI01, ensuring system flexibility and scalability.
Q6: What certifications does the IPBLC01 hold?
A6: The IPBLC01 is certified with CE, RoHS, and UL, ensuring compliance with international safety and environmental standards.
